Born in New Westminster, British Columbia, Canada in May 1917, Raymond Burr began his career on Broadway before transitioning to radio and eventually television and film. His name became synonymous with iconic characters like Perry Mason and Robert T. Ironside.
During his illustrious career, Burr amassed over 140 acting credits to his name, showcasing his versatility as an actor. From 1957 to 1966, he captivated audiences as Perry Mason in the popular TV series of the same name. Following that success, from 1967 to 1975, Burr took on the role of Robert T. Ironside in the equally beloved series Ironside.
Burr’s talent extended beyond television series; he also starred in numerous films throughout his career. One notable role was portraying Perry Mason once again in various TV movies. This dedication further solidified his status as one of Hollywood’s most recognized actors.
Recognition for Burr’s exceptional talent didn’t stop at viewers’ admiration alone. He won two Primetime Emmy Awards for his portrayal of Perry Mason and received two Golden Globe Award nominations for his outstanding performance as Robert T. Ironside.
